Skip to main content

A tool meant to check inter-device speeds via ssh

Project description

speedtest_ssh

A simple tool for a quick and easy speedtest between two machines using ssh

Usage

This tool will attempt to use the ssh config in ~/.ssh/config for fields not provided.

usage: speedtest-ssh [-h] [--version] [-u USERNAME] [--password PASSWORD]
                     [--port PORT] [--num_seconds NUM_SECONDS]
                     [-m {rsync,sftp}]
                     host

positional arguments:
  host                  The host to speedtest the conection to

options:
  -h, --help            show this help message and exit
  --version             show program's version number and exit
  -u USERNAME, --username USERNAME
                        The username to use to ssh
  --password PASSWORD   The password to use to ssh
  --port PORT           The port to use to ssh
  --num_seconds NUM_SECONDS
                        An approximate amount of time this test should take
  -m {rsync,sftp}, --mode {rsync,sftp}
                        The speedtest method. Defaults to rsync

Notes

  1. This will be subject to your disk read/write speed in /tmp on both devices

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

speedtest_ssh-2.10.0.tar.gz (21.3 kB view details)

Uploaded Source

Built Distribution

speedtest_ssh-2.10.0-py3-none-any.whl (22.7 kB view details)

Uploaded Python 3

File details

Details for the file speedtest_ssh-2.10.0.tar.gz.

File metadata

  • Download URL: speedtest_ssh-2.10.0.tar.gz
  • Upload date:
  • Size: 21.3 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.7

File hashes

Hashes for speedtest_ssh-2.10.0.tar.gz
Algorithm Hash digest
SHA256 2356be05618b2ac6c67c074826ab5cebe4de143159f5f342c8cea1ac54c3f380
MD5 9efb0fc97543823392aae094197f6282
BLAKE2b-256 844193b83f5f234ce92932c4e2d672258214ff8ccea25cb898630b94a4e48efd

See more details on using hashes here.

File details

Details for the file speedtest_ssh-2.10.0-py3-none-any.whl.

File metadata

File hashes

Hashes for speedtest_ssh-2.10.0-py3-none-any.whl
Algorithm Hash digest
SHA256 a953b5777c5743c378e52ebbdfdbf688ee7d8aa3e24cc2d19ea55ab3431d4435
MD5 3eb9e51f7bb0ed2dbe94395963ccec39
BLAKE2b-256 a9282dc641e10a65451eee30a483d1622576a1d4f7630039e16cf11c9032a463

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page